public JsonResult AddUpdatePageUser(LP_PageUser_Property objpageuser) { try { int userid = Convert.ToInt16(Session["UID"].ToString()); List <LP_PageUser_Property> pageserlist = new List <LP_PageUser_Property>(); //DBClass.db.Database.ExecuteSqlCommand("Delete from PageUsers where UserID={0}", timeline.UserID); //DBClass.db.SaveChanges(); for (int i = 0; i < objpageuser.PageList.Count; i++) { LP_PageUser_Property objpguser = new LP_PageUser_Property(); objpguser.UserID = objpageuser.UserID; objpguser.PageID = objpageuser.PageList[i].ID; objpguser.CreatedDate = DateTime.Now; objpguser.status = true; objpguser.CreatedBy = userid; pageserlist.Add(objpguser); } objpageuser.DetailData = Helper.ToDataTable <LP_PageUser_Property>(pageserlist); objUserBll = new User_BLL(); bool flag = objUserBll.UpdatePageUser(objpageuser); return(Json(new { success = flag, statuscode = 200, url = "/Account/PageUser" }, JsonRequestBehavior.AllowGet)); } catch (Exception ex) { return(Json(new { success = false }, JsonRequestBehavior.AllowGet)); } }